Event Description
A greenfield vena cava filter was previously implanted in the inferior vena cava.On (b)(6) 2020, the patient had a computerized tomography (ct) scan that showed the filter had tilted to a 17 degree angle to the left, the apex of the filter perforated the ivc wall by 5mm, and several filter struts were bending.The device remains in an unsafe location.No further complications reported.
